Meet Sam, Guangping (Sam) Song. RMT | Registered Massage Therapist | Authorized RMT acupuncture modality service provider. Sam is a Registered Massage Therapist who graduated from the Royal Canadian College of Massage Therapy and brings several years of clinical experience to his practice. He focuses on providing effective, therapeutic treatments designed to help clients reduce pain, restore mobility, and improve overall well-being. Sam’s treatments typically involve over-the-sheet massage therapy techniques, moderate pressure, and assisted stretching, creating a comfortable and effective experience for a wide range of clients. Many clients appreciate his focused approach to addressing tension and mobility restrictions while maintaining a relaxing treatment environment. Sam has particular experience supporting clients with conditions such as neck and shoulder tension, back pain, leg pain, sciatica, headaches, knee osteoarthritis, seasonal allergy-related discomfort, and postherpetic neuralgia (shingles-related nerve pain). As an RMT trained in doing acupuncture, Sam may occasionally recommend acupuncture as part of a treatment plan when he feels it could provide additional benefit. However, acupuncture is always optional, and clients are welcome to decline if they prefer massage therapy alone.
